软件研发项目管理中如何进行项目成本管理?

在软件研发项目管理中,项目成本管理是确保项目在预算范围内顺利完成的关键环节。有效的成本管理不仅能够提高项目的经济效益,还能够保证项目的质量与进度。以下将从成本估算、成本控制、成本分析和成本报告四个方面详细探讨如何进行项目成本管理。

一、成本估算

  1. 成本估算的重要性

成本估算是项目成本管理的第一步,它对项目的整体成本控制具有决定性作用。准确的成本估算有助于项目管理者制定合理的预算,避免项目超支。


  1. 成本估算的方法

(1)类比估算:通过参考历史项目或类似项目的成本数据,对当前项目进行估算。

(2)参数估算:根据项目规模、技术难度等因素,运用统计方法估算成本。

(3)自底向上估算:从项目最底层的活动开始,逐步向上汇总,得到整个项目的成本估算。

(4)三点估算:采用最乐观、最可能和最悲观三种情况下的成本估算,计算加权平均值。

二、成本控制

  1. 成本控制的重要性

成本控制是项目成本管理的核心环节,它通过对项目成本进行实时监控和调整,确保项目在预算范围内顺利完成。


  1. 成本控制的方法

(1)制定预算:根据成本估算结果,制定项目预算,明确各项费用的支出范围。

(2)成本预算分配:将项目预算分配到各个阶段、各个部门,确保项目各环节的成本控制。

(3)成本监控:实时监控项目成本,发现偏差及时采取措施进行调整。

(4)变更控制:对项目变更进行成本评估,确保变更后的项目成本在预算范围内。

三、成本分析

  1. 成本分析的重要性

成本分析是项目成本管理的重要环节,它有助于项目管理者了解项目成本构成,发现问题,为后续的成本控制提供依据。


  1. 成本分析的方法

(1)挣值分析(EVM):通过比较实际成本、计划成本和预算成本,分析项目成本绩效。

(2)成本趋势分析:分析项目成本随时间的变化趋势,预测项目成本未来走势。

(3)成本构成分析:分析项目成本构成,找出成本高企的原因,为成本控制提供依据。

四、成本报告

  1. 成本报告的重要性

成本报告是项目成本管理的重要成果,它向项目干系人展示项目成本状况,为项目决策提供依据。


  1. 成本报告的内容

(1)项目成本概览:包括项目总成本、已发生成本、剩余成本等。

(2)成本绩效分析:包括实际成本、计划成本和预算成本的对比分析。

(3)成本趋势分析:分析项目成本随时间的变化趋势。

(4)成本构成分析:分析项目成本构成,找出成本高企的原因。

(5)成本控制措施:总结项目成本控制措施,为后续项目提供借鉴。

总结

在软件研发项目管理中,项目成本管理是一项系统工程,涉及多个环节。通过有效的成本估算、成本控制、成本分析和成本报告,项目管理者可以确保项目在预算范围内顺利完成,提高项目经济效益。在实际操作中,项目管理者应根据项目特点,灵活运用各种成本管理方法,实现项目成本的有效控制。

猜你喜欢:金融业项目管理